{"id":116701,"date":"2020-02-01T05:01:35","date_gmt":"2020-02-01T05:01:35","guid":{"rendered":"https:\/\/wordpress.org\/plugins\/firebase-push-notification-from-wp\/"},"modified":"2024-06-23T18:34:34","modified_gmt":"2024-06-23T18:34:34","slug":"fcm-push-notification-from-wp","status":"publish","type":"plugin","link":"https:\/\/twd.wordpress.org\/plugins\/fcm-push-notification-from-wp\/","author":16610462,"comment_status":"closed","ping_status":"closed","template":"","meta":{"_crdt_document":"","version":"1.9.1","stable_tag":"trunk","tested":"6.5.8","requires":"4.6","requires_php":"5.6.20","requires_plugins":null,"header_name":"FCM Push Notification from WP","header_author":"dprogrammer","header_description":"Notify your users using Firebase Cloud Messaging (FCM) when content is published or updated","assets_banners_color":"b275a6","last_updated":"2024-06-23 18:34:34","external_support_url":"","external_repository_url":"","donate_link":"https:\/\/www.buymeacoffee.com\/dprogrammer","header_plugin_uri":"","header_author_uri":"https:\/\/www.buymeacoffee.com\/dprogrammer","rating":4.3,"author_block_rating":0,"active_installs":600,"downloads":14456,"num_ratings":6,"support_threads":0,"support_threads_resolved":0,"author_block_count":0,"sections":["description","installation","faq","changelog"],"tags":[],"upgrade_notice":[],"ratings":{"1":1,"2":0,"3":0,"4":0,"5":5},"assets_icons":{"icon-128x128.png":{"filename":"icon-128x128.png","revision":2236793,"resolution":"128x128","location":"assets","locale":""},"icon-256x256.png":{"filename":"icon-256x256.png","revision":2236794,"resolution":"256x256","location":"assets","locale":""}},"assets_banners":{"banner-1544x500.png":{"filename":"banner-1544x500.png","revision":2613094,"resolution":"1544x500","location":"assets","locale":""},"banner-772x250.png":{"filename":"banner-772x250.png","revision":2613094,"resolution":"772x250","location":"assets","locale":""}},"assets_blueprints":{},"all_blocks":[],"tagged_versions":[],"block_files":[],"assets_screenshots":{"screenshot-1.png":{"filename":"screenshot-1.png","revision":2236785,"resolution":"1","location":"assets","locale":""},"screenshot-2.png":{"filename":"screenshot-2.png","revision":2236787,"resolution":"2","location":"assets","locale":""},"screenshot-3.png":{"filename":"screenshot-3.png","revision":2236788,"resolution":"3","location":"assets","locale":""},"screenshot-4.png":{"filename":"screenshot-4.png","revision":2236789,"resolution":"4","location":"assets","locale":""},"screenshot-5.png":{"filename":"screenshot-5.png","revision":2446404,"resolution":"5","location":"assets","locale":""},"screenshot-6.png":{"filename":"screenshot-6.png","revision":2446404,"resolution":"6","location":"assets","locale":""},"screenshot-7.png":{"filename":"screenshot-7.png","revision":2613094,"resolution":"7","location":"assets","locale":""},"screenshot-8.png":{"filename":"screenshot-8.png","revision":2613094,"resolution":"8","location":"assets","locale":""}},"screenshots":{"1":"Plugin settings screen.","2":"Sending from a post.","3":"Sending from a custom post type.","4":"Sending from a page.","5":"Sending from a scheduled post.","6":"Notification and data message fields.","7":"Test performed using WordPress 5.8.1. Opening the notification within the app.","8":"Test performed using WordPress 5.8.1. Notification being displayed when the app is closed."},"jetpack_post_was_ever_published":false},"plugin_section":[],"plugin_tags":[1128,143080,14432,1159,7290],"plugin_category":[],"plugin_contributors":[181415],"plugin_business_model":[],"class_list":["post-116701","plugin","type-plugin","status-publish","hentry","plugin_tags-android","plugin_tags-fcm","plugin_tags-firebase","plugin_tags-notification","plugin_tags-push","plugin_contributors-dprogrammer","plugin_committers-dprogrammer"],"banners":{"banner":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/banner-772x250.png?rev=2613094","banner_2x":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/banner-1544x500.png?rev=2613094","banner_rtl":false,"banner_2x_rtl":false},"icons":{"svg":false,"icon":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/icon-128x128.png?rev=2236793","icon_2x":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/icon-256x256.png?rev=2236794","generated":false},"screenshots":[{"src":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/screenshot-1.png?rev=2236785","caption":"Plugin settings screen."},{"src":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/screenshot-2.png?rev=2236787","caption":"Sending from a post."},{"src":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/screenshot-3.png?rev=2236788","caption":"Sending from a custom post type."},{"src":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/screenshot-4.png?rev=2236789","caption":"Sending from a page."},{"src":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/screenshot-5.png?rev=2446404","caption":"Sending from a scheduled post."},{"src":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/screenshot-6.png?rev=2446404","caption":"Notification and data message fields."},{"src":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/screenshot-7.png?rev=2613094","caption":"Test performed using WordPress 5.8.1. Opening the notification within the app."},{"src":"https:\/\/ps.w.org\/fcm-push-notification-from-wp\/assets\/screenshot-8.png?rev=2613094","caption":"Test performed using WordPress 5.8.1. Notification being displayed when the app is closed."}],"raw_content":"<!--section=description-->\n<p>Notifications for posts, pages and custom post types.<\/p>\n\n<p>Works with scheduled posts.<\/p>\n\n<p>Send notifications to users of your app from your website using Google's service, Firebase Push Notification.<\/p>\n\n<p>The notification sent includes the block with the data message to be handled by the application, even when it is in the background.<\/p>\n\n<p>Configure the plugin to start sending notifications.<\/p>\n\n<p>Send custom field values \u200b\u200bin the notification, in the data option.<\/p>\n\n<p>Send a notification when you post news or update your content. When editing, the option is deselected to send you to accidentally send a new notification. Check if you want to send a new notification when editing.<\/p>\n\n<p>Compatible with apps developed with the SDK Flutter.<\/p>\n\n<p>You need to register users on the same topic (fcm) that was informed in the plugin configuration. This plugin is not intended for sending notifications to websites.<\/p>\n\n<p>Support my work\n<a href=\"https:\/\/www.buymeacoffee.com\/dprogrammer\">https:\/\/www.buymeacoffee.com\/dprogrammer<\/a><\/p>\n\n<!--section=installation-->\n<ol>\n<li>Upload the plugin files to the <code>\/wp-content\/plugins\/fcm-push-notification-from-wp<\/code> directory, or install the plugin through the WordPress plugins screen directly.<\/li>\n<li>Activate the plugin through the 'Plugins' screen in WordPress.<\/li>\n<li>Use the Settings-&gt;FCM Push Notification from WordPress screen to configure the plugin.<\/li>\n<li>In the FCM Options put the FCM API Key and put the topic name registered in your app.<\/li>\n<li>Optionally put the image url to display in the notification.<\/li>\n<\/ol>\n\n<!--section=faq-->\n<dl>\n<dt id='does%20it%20work%20with%20scheduled%20posts%3F'><h3>Does it work with scheduled posts?<\/h3><\/dt>\n<dd><p>Yes. When a post changes the status from scheduled to published, a notification is sent. If the option was checked when saving the post.<\/p><\/dd>\n<dt id='can%20i%20send%20to%20one%20user%20only%3F'><h3>Can I send to one user only?<\/h3><\/dt>\n<dd><p>No. You can only send to the topic informed in the plugin configuration.<\/p>\n\n<p>All users receive notification.<\/p><\/dd>\n<dt id='can%20i%20disable%20sending%20on%20the%20publication%20screen%3F'><h3>Can I disable sending on the publication screen?<\/h3><\/dt>\n<dd><p>Yes. Uncheck the checkbox to not send a notification.<\/p><\/dd>\n<dt id='can%20i%20send%20to%20my%20site%20user%3F'><h3>Can I send to my site user?<\/h3><\/dt>\n<dd><p>No. sends only to users who are using your android\/ios app.<\/p><\/dd>\n\n<\/dl>\n\n<!--section=changelog-->\n<h4>1.0.0<\/h4>\n\n<ul>\n<li>First version.<\/li>\n<\/ul>\n\n<h4>1.1.0<\/h4>\n\n<ul>\n<li>Bug fixes.<\/li>\n<\/ul>\n\n<h4>1.2.0<\/h4>\n\n<ul>\n<li>Bring the option unchecked when editing a post.<\/li>\n<\/ul>\n\n<h4>1.3.0<\/h4>\n\n<ul>\n<li>Sending notification for scheduled posts.<\/li>\n<li>Bug fixes.<\/li>\n<\/ul>\n\n<h4>1.4.0<\/h4>\n\n<ul>\n<li>Bug fixes. Two notifications were sent when sending.<\/li>\n<\/ul>\n\n<h4>1.5.0<\/h4>\n\n<ul>\n<li>Bug fixes. this plugin was not sending the permalink when editing a post. Solution sent by @alchmi. Thanks.<\/li>\n<\/ul>\n\n<h4>1.6.0<\/h4>\n\n<ul>\n<li>Included routine to remove visual composer tags from page and post text.<\/li>\n<\/ul>\n\n<h4>1.7.0<\/h4>\n\n<ul>\n<li>Included the Sound field in the configuration. If empty, the name of the sound will be \"default\".<\/li>\n<\/ul>\n\n<h4>1.8.0<\/h4>\n\n<ul>\n<li>Bug fixes.<\/li>\n<\/ul>\n\n<h4>1.9.0<\/h4>\n\n<ul>\n<li>Option to take values \u200b\u200bfrom custom fields and include in data area.<\/li>\n<li>Fixed text notifications display with '.<\/li>\n<li>Fixed notification display when using Divi theme.<\/li>\n<\/ul>\n\n<h4>1.9.1<\/h4>\n\n<ul>\n<li>Bug fixes.<\/li>\n<\/ul>","raw_excerpt":"Notify your users using Firebase Cloud Messaging (FCM) when content is published or updated.","j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/116701","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=116701"}],"author":[{"embeddable":true,"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/dprogrammer"}],"wp:attachment":[{"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=116701"}],"wp:term":[{"taxonomy":"plugin_section","embeddable":true,"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_section?post=116701"},{"taxonomy":"plugin_tags","embeddable":true,"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_tags?post=116701"},{"taxonomy":"plugin_category","embeddable":true,"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_category?post=116701"},{"taxonomy":"plugin_contributors","embeddable":true,"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_contributors?post=116701"},{"taxonomy":"plugin_business_model","embeddable":true,"href":"https:\/\/twd.w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in_business_model?post=116701"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}